Cryer Malt now supplies KeyKeg to Australia's craft beer industry.

With Cryer Malt joining OneCircle’s Australian reseller network, we continue to strengthen our commitment to the country and its dynamic craft beer scene. From their distribution centre in Melbourne, Cryer Malt will distribute KeyKeg to brewers across the country, supporting the growing trend for strong, sturdy and sustainable beer packaging.

It has been five years since KeyKeg was launched in Australia, and together with well-respected resellers like Cryer Malt we can help breweries protect their beer, quality and flavor. KeyKeg keeps craft beer as fresh as the day it was produced and protects it during the journey from brewery to consumer.

The Cryer Malt team are ‘total brewing revolutionaries’ who not only supply the finest brewing ingredients to breweries across Australia but also have over 25 years’ experience helping to develop the country’s modern craft beer scene. Founder David Cryer’s recent peer-nominated Lifetime Achievement Award at the 2021 Indies is a testament to Cryer Malt’s highly respected role in the industry. Marketing and sales support manager Steph Howard’s Young Gun of the Year honor also confirms Cryer Malt’s ongoing commitment to building relationships into the future.

Cryer Malt’s knowledgeable team support breweries across the country with a full package of high-quality ingredients, and the addition of a high-quality beer Keg to their range is a natural fit to provide even better service. Improved logistics and a simplified ordering process enhance the customer experience too. With access to Cryer Malt’s wider range of value-add products, breweries place one order and receive their ingredients and KeyKegs in one delivery — ideal for remote breweries as well as city-center brewpubs.

The brewery experience is further enhanced by Cryer Malt offering more flexible ordering quantities and trading accounts with payment terms, Australian-dollar transactions and faster delivery.
